The Bay's most liveable town.

Tivat sits at the narrowest point of the Bay of Kotor, where the mountains pull back just enough to let the sun in. For most of the 20th century it was home to the Yugoslav Navy's main arsenal — a vast industrial compound on the waterfront that most towns would have torn down.

Instead, it was transformed into Porto Montenegro: a 24-hectare luxury superyacht marina with restaurants, boutiques, a Naval Heritage Collection museum, and berths for vessels up to 250 metres. The Cold War submarine is still there, now a museum exhibit. It's an unlikely combination that somehow works.

Beyond the marina, Tivat is an ordinary Montenegrin coastal town with a tree-lined promenade, a handful of good seafood restaurants, and a relaxed pace that Kotor — 20 minutes away — rarely manages in high season. Tivat Airport (TIV) sits 5 minutes from the centre, making it the easiest entry point to the entire bay.

If you're flying into TIV and heading to Kotor, don't bother with a taxi. The local bus runs directly from the airport stop to Kotor for under €3 — same road, far cheaper. Ask the driver to confirm before boarding.

Best time to visit Tivat.

Tivat gets more sunshine than any other town in the Bay of Kotor — but the tourist season follows the same rhythm as the rest of the coast.

Spring Apr – May
Excellent

Warm and uncrowded. Porto Montenegro starts filling up but the town is calm. Great for cycling along the promenade and day trips around the bay. Temperatures 18–24°C.

Summer Jun – Aug
Peak season

The marina fills with superyachts, the beach bars open late, and prices rise sharply. Book accommodation 2–3 months ahead. Temperatures 28–34°C. Busy but energetic.

Autumn Sep – Oct
Excellent

Our favourite time. Sea stays warm into October, crowds drop after the first week of September, and the light on the bay is extraordinary. Prices fall 30–40% from peak.

Winter Nov – Mar
Quiet

Most marina restaurants close. The town is very local and very peaceful. Mild by Adriatic standards — rarely below 8°C. Good for long walks and cheap apartments.

Getting there

Get to Tivat by bus.

Tivat is well-connected by bus to other cities in Montenegro and the wider region. The town centre and Porto Montenegro are within easy reach of the bus station.

There is no train to Tivat — bus and private transfer are the main ground transport options from Podgorica and the rest of the coast.

Nearby destinations.

Tivat's central position in the Bay of Kotor makes it the ideal base for exploring the entire coast.

Kotor 10 km from Tivat

Medieval walled city and UNESCO World Heritage Site — the most dramatic destination on the Bay of Kotor.

Perast 20 km from Tivat

A Baroque village of just 300 residents with two tiny island churches in the bay. One of the most romantic spots in the Adriatic.

Budva 35 km from Tivat

Montenegro's busiest resort town — sandy beaches, a compact medieval old town, and the liveliest nightlife on the coast.
